Configuring Multiple VLANS per SSID
The SSID acts as a "security template" - it determines the general security mode (WPA, WEP,
etc.). The Security details (the keys themselves) are linked to the VLAN. Therefore, there is an
option to assign multiple VLAN to the same "security template" which is the SSID.
This option is applicable only when another authority (i.e. RADIUS Server that supports VLAN
assignment) is involved in the Authentication process. The RADIUS can determine the exact
VLAN that the connecting client is bound to after the Authentication process is completed.
Perform steps 1-10 in Configuring VLAN above.
In the Security Configuration, under Authentication, if you select WPA RADIUS you enable
RADIUS authentication. In this case, there is an option to edit multiple VLAN, one after the
other. You can add VLAN by pressing the “Add VLAN” button. There can be up to 16 VLAN in
the overall system in SSID-VLAN, and up to 6 in BSSID mode.
